Stock Market Today, June 10: Robinhood Markets Rises on IPO Underwriting Announcement
Robinhood Markets (HOOD) rose about 3.1% to close near $86.36 on June 10 after CEO Vlad Tenev said the company received regulatory approval to underwrite IPOs. The stock traded between $84.08 and $91.44 with volume well above average. Broader IPO underwriting could expand offerings, according to the company.

Background
HOOD is a commission-free trading platform for stocks and crypto; it IPO’d in 2021 and has been expanding product offerings.
Why it matters
Regulatory approval to underwrite IPOs broadens HOOD’s offerings and potentially increases its participation in the currently strong IPO market, supporting investor expectations for revenue growth.

Alternative perspectives
Regulatory approval may not translate into meaningful underwriting revenue quickly; execution, underwriting capacity, and deal access could lag the headline.
The article doesn’t specify scope/conditions of approval, underwriting limits, or expected ramp; regulatory risk remains cited as the biggest threat.
